Generate Multitemporal Coherence (Image Analyst Tools)
Summary
Generates a false color composite image using ground range detected and the coherence products. Each band in the composite is composed of different synthetic aperture radar (SAR) acquisitions, which are derived from complex radar products.
Usage
In SAR applications, multitemporal coherence is necessary for ensuring accurate change detection, classification, and deformation monitoring by assessing the temporal change of backscatter signals across multiple SAR acquisitions.
The input must be terrain corrected SAR data. Use the Apply Geometric Terrain Correction tool to orthorectify input radar data.
